Jeff calls FTD flowers and the following conversation occurs with Jill from FTD. Jeff : Hello, I would like to order 12 dozen red roses for my mother for Mother's Day". She lives in LA, CA.

Jill: The current price for 12 dozen red roses (144 roses) is $599, we take Visa, MasterCard and American Express, and that price includes delivery anywhere in LA.

Jack: Wow, sounds good! Here's my credit card information, I'll take the 12 dozen roses.

FTD contracts with Flowers R Us (FRU) to deliver flowers in the LA area. FRU contacts mom the day before the delivery to confirm her address. Mom was very excited for the upcoming delivery, because just yesterday she had ordered flowers from ABC flowers for a funeral she was attending. Mom decided to bring her son's flowers to the funeral and canceled her order with ABC Flowers.

The next day the delivery person from FRU showed up to mom's front door with the 12 dozen yellow flowers and asked for an additional $100. FRU states that they couldn't deliver the flowers because FTD should have charged her son $699. Although Mom reluctantly pays the extra $100 for the 12 dozen roses, she is not satisfied because Jack was promised 12 dozen red roses not yellow roses

INSTRUCTIONS:

Describe a IRAC(ISSUE, RULE, ANALYSIS,CONCLUSION) on this following scenario, go into depth about contraction formation and third party rights and into defenses to breach.
